In our last issue of Launchpad we addressed the need for marketing and advertising investment during a recession, to maintain market share and to enable a swift recovery when the market picks up. The question now is, how do you maximise your heavily cut marketing budget for maximum return?
As the marketing purse strings are tightened, businesses must look to advertise in smart and measurable ways. The good news is, you don’t have to hire the biggest agency in town to achieve this. Smaller agencies can respond to changing market conditions faster than big agencies and with lower overheads they can afford to charge less for equally high quality work.
